Chapter 17 Section 1

Reconstruction Plans Objectives:

1. Identify the parts of the Lincoln, Radical, and Johnson Reconstruction Plans

2. Describe what the Freeman’s Bureau was to do for freedman.

I. Reconstruction Plans

A. Lincoln or 10 percent Plan

1. Only 10% of the voters of a state needed to pledge loyalty to the United States

2. Had to adopt a state constitution that banned slavery

3. Lincoln was willing to give amnesty to those who supported the Union

a. This is a pardon

4. Lincoln wanted the nation to start healing immediately

B. Radical Plan

1. This plan came from Congress

2. Group of Republicans wanted the south to pay for starting the war

3. Would not allow any Senator or Representative take a seat in congress if they were

elected under the Lincoln Plan

4. This group was led by Thaddeus Stevens

5. Finally the congress passed their plan called the Wade-Davis Bill

a. A majority of voters had to pledge loyalty to the United States

b. Only non-confederate soldiers and officers were allowed to hold offices

c. Must ban slavery

C. Compromise is needed

1. Lincoln and the Radicals could not agree

2. They agreed on one topic: the Freedman’s Bureau

a. Former slaves are considered freedman

b. Was to help black get food, clothing and medicine

c. Get blacks jobs and land

d. Also helped blacks get an education

D. Johnson Plan

1. Was passed after Lincoln was assassinated

2. His plan stated

a. All southerners could gain amnesty

b. That any high officials needed to ask the President directly

c. Johnson believed that only southern whites should run the south

d. Thought blacks should not be equals

e. Must pass the 13th

Amendment that abolished slavery

f. The state must denounce secession
